Job Description - Executive Director, Senior Lead Financial Accountant

About this role:

Wells Fargo is seeking an Executive Director, Senior Lead Financial Accountant so support Regulatory Interpretations & Reporting. This senior individual contributor is responsible for the interpretation, governance, and execution of broker-dealer regulatory reporting. This role acts as a key subject matter expert, translating complex regulatory requirements into clear, actionable guidance while driving consistency, accuracy, and timely compliance across the organization. Partners closely with Finance, Risk, Treasury, and business stakeholders to align on reporting treatment and strengthen the control environment.


In this role, you will:

  • Own regulatory interpretation framework: Provide authoritative guidance on regulatory reporting rules and capital requirements, resolving complex interpretive issues

  • Oversee regulatory reporting execution: Ensure completeness, accuracy, and timeliness of filings to regulatory agencies (e.g., FINRA, SEC) 

  • Drive consistency and governance: Establish standardized policies, controls, and processes across reports and business lines

  • Partner cross-functionally: Align Finance, Risk, Treasury, and business stakeholders on reporting treatment and data requirements

  • Enhance control environment: Strengthen data lineage, documentation, and audit readiness for regulatory submissions

  • Lead regulatory engagement & advocacy: Interface with regulators and influence interpretation of evolving rules

Required Qualifications:

  • 7+ years of Finance, Accounting, Analytics, Financial Reporting, Accounting Reporting or Risk Reporting exper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, education


Desired Qualifications:

  • Deep expertise in SEC and FINRA broker-dealer regulatory reporting, including capital and FOCUS reporting

  • Proven ability to interpret complex regulatory requirements and translate them into clear, actionable reporting guidance

  • Strong experience in influencing senior stakeholders across Finance, Risk, and Treasury without direct authority

  • Background in data governance, data lineage, and regulatory reporting infrastructure

  • Experience enhancing controls, audit readiness, and regulatory compliance frameworks

  • Demonstrated involvement in regulatory exams, inquiries, or remediation efforts

  • Ability to drive consistency and standardization across reporting processes and business lines

  • Advanced analytical and problem-solving skills with a track record of resolving ambiguous interpretive issues
